Felix Group Holdings ASX:FLX OCF Yield % is -22.40 as of Jun. 27, 2026. The stock has 2 warning signs investors should review. Among 2,868 Software companies, Felix Group Holdings ranks worse than 89.37% on this metric.

OCF Yield % is calculated as Cash Flow from Operations divided by Market Capitalization. It is a financial solvency ratio that compares the operating cash flow a company is expected to earn against its market value.

As of today, Felix Group Holdings's Trailing 12-Month Cash Flow from Operations is A$-3.68 Mil, and Market Cap is A$16.42 Mil. Therefore, Felix Group Holdings's OCF Yield % for today is -22.40%.

Felix Group Holdings OCF Yield % Calculation

OCF Yield % is a financial solvency ratio that compares the operating cash flow a company is expected to earn against its market value.

Felix Group Holdings's OCF Yield % for the fiscal year that ended in Jun. 2025 is calculated as

OCF Yield %=Cash Flow from Operations / Market Cap
=0.417 / 37.8325
=1.10%

Felix Group Holdings's annualized OCF Yield % for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

OCF Yield %=Cash Flow from Operations * Annualized Factor / Market Cap
=-3.601 * 2 / 49.252665
=-14.62%

Felix Group Holdings Ltd is an online construction marketplace for people to list, find, and hire equipment and subcontractors. The solutions offered by the company include Vendor Management, Sourcing, Contracts, c, and APIs and integrations. The company generates maximum revenue from Enterprise Saas (Contractors) Revenue. The Company has developed and operates a cloud-based enterprise SaaS and marketplace platform called Felix that automates and streamlines a range of critical procurement-focused business processes for organisations from the commercial construction.
